BMBOM command
Inserts a Bill of Materials (BOM) table in the current drawing.

Icon:
Options within the command
- Name
- Specifies the table name.
- Top level
- Creates a BOM of the top-level components only.
- Bottom level
- Creates a BOM of the subcomponents.
- Hierarchical
- Creates a hierarchical BOM listing all (sub)components.
- Load from template
- Creates a BOM from a template.
- Save as template
- Saves the current BOM configuration as a template.
- LAyout
- Changes the current layout.
- Configure
- Add additional columns to your BOM table.
- Description
- Add a description column.
- dEnsity
- Add a density column.
- Volume
- Add a volume column.
- Mass
- Add a mass column.
- parameterS
- If multiple inserts of the same parametric component exist in the assembly, they will be grouped in different BOM rows depending on the values of the parameters.
- mAterials
- Add a material column.
- Thickness
- Add a thickness column.
- More
- Displays more configuration options.
- Toggle column
- Adds or removes columns from the BOM.
- add Formula field
- Adds a formula field.
- Set sorting
- Sets the sorting mode for BOM.
- Automatic
- Sets the automatic sorting for the table.
- No sorting
- Disables the sorting for the BOM.
- Custom sorting
- Specifies the column for sorting.
- Toggle sorting column
- Sets the sorting mode for columns.
- column Properties
- Configures columns.
- Name
- Sets the name of the column.
- Visibility
- Sets the visibility of the column.
- ON
- Sets the visibility of the column to on.
- OFF
- Sets the visibility of the column to off.
- Width
- Sets the column width.
- Auto
- Sets the automatic width of the column.
- Prefix
- Sets the prefix for numbers in the Number column.
- Suffix
- Sets the suffix for numbers in the Number column.
- Footer type
- Sets the footer type.
- None
- Removes the column from the footer.
- Sum
- Adds the total sum to the footer.
- Average
- Adds the average value to the footer.
- MINimum
- Adds the minimal value to the footer.
- MAXimum
- Adds the maximal value to the footer.
- Aggregate function
- Sets the aggregate function.
- None
- Removes an aggregate function from the column.
- Sum
- Shows the total sum of values in the group.
- Average
- Shows the average value of values in the group.
- MINimum
- Shows the lowest value in the group.
- MAXimum
- Shows the highest value in the group.
- CONcatenate
- Combines all values in the group using the provided delimiter.
- CONCatenate with count
- Combines all values in the group with their number using the provided delimiters, prefix and suffix.
- sEttings
- Configures the aggregated column.
- value Separator
- Sets the delimiter between concatenated values.
- count Position
- Sets the position of the number of encounters for concatenated values.
- After value
- The number of instances is placed after the corresponding value.
- bEfore value
- The number of instances is placed before the corresponding value.
- Count separator
- Sets the delimiter between a value and its number of encounters.
- count PREfix
- Sets the prefix that will be added before the number of encounters.
- count SUFfix
- Sets the suffix that will be added after the number of encounters.
- Units
- Configures units and how they display.
- unit Mode
- Sets the units for the column values.
- Best for All
- The best unit for all values.
- BEst for each value
- The best unit for each value.
- set Fixed unit
- Choose the unit manually.
- unit Format
- Sets how the units display.
- Title
- Places the unit symbol in the column title.
- Same cell
- Places the unit symbol in the same cell as the value.
- separate Column
- Places the unit symbol in a separate column.
- do Not show units
- Hides the units symbol.
- title Format
- Sets the format for the column title for the Title option.
- fOrmat string
- Sets the format string for column values.
- Role
- Sets the column role for the column.
- Regular
- Sets the regular role for the column.
- Number
- Sets the number role for the column. (So it will be used as the number source for the BMBALLON command).
- nAme
- Sets the name role for the column. (So it will be used as the name source for the BMBALLON command).
- Quantity
- Sets the quantity role for the column. (So it will be used as the quantity source for the BMBALLON command).
- table sEttings
- Configures the properties of a BOM table.
- footer Title
- Sets the title of the footer row.
- Filter
- Sets the table filter.
- Property set
- Specify the properties to add from.
- Mechanical only
- Only mechanical properties of components and instances will be available.
- all Except coordinates
- All properties of mechanical components and instances will be available, including properties of associated database entities, except coordinates.
- All
- All properties of mechanical components and instances will be available, including properties of associated database entities.
- Grouping mode
- Specifies the grouping mode for the current table.
- Auto
- Groups the parts with respect to their definitions and parameters.
- by COmponents and columns
- Groups the parts with respect to their definitions and properties used in the table.
- by Columns only
- Groups the parts with respect to their properties used in the table only. (So one row may correspond to completely different parts if their properties displayed in BOM are the same).
- Counting mode
- Specifies the counting mode for hierarchical BOM.
- by Document
- Sets the counting mode to count all instances.
- by parent Component
- Sets the counting mode to count instances in parent component.
- Selection set
- Specifies the selection method for the BOM.
- Entire model
- Creates a BOM for the entire model.
- Subassembly
- Creates a BOM for the selected subassembly.
- Custom selection
- Creates a BOM for the selected components.
- drawing View
- Specifies one or more drawing views.
- layout viewPOrt
- Specifies one or more layout viewports.
- fixed coRner
- Specifies the position of the insertion point of the table.
- Back
- Returns to the previous prompt.